Enterprise Mobile Application Development: The Future of Business
Enterprise mobile application development has become unique in this evolving technology landscape. It is a transformative force shaping every business's future.
The increasing demands for enterprise mobile applications have created challenges for mobile software development. This has led most enterprises to improve their sustainability in this competitive market.
So, this blog will help you understand about enterprise mobile application development. It would allow you to think about using enterprise mobile application development services for the exponential growth of your business.
You may understand what goes into the enterprise app development process and its fundamental steps. This article will answer relevant questions about enterprise mobile application development and related terms.?
Understanding Enterprise Mobile Application Development?
Enterprise mobile application development has become the best partner for large companies in creating software. It meets business requirements by tailoring the software through web and mobile development services.
Custom enterprise apps that integrate with an organization's existing systems would benefit a company. Enterprise app development companies may also help businesses as these apps aim to enhance communication and collaboration.?
Types of Enterprise Mobile Application Development?
Enterprise mobile application development companies understand varying business and organizational requirements. They offer different types of custom mobile application development services to meet business necessities.
We can classify enterprise mobile application development into three main categories. You may understand some common types of these applications based on their purpose and target audience.?
Employee-Level Enterprise Application?
Your business may benefit from employee-level enterprise applications as reliable tools that track time. These apps improve productivity & efficiency, assisting in collaboration, communication, and project management. Enterprise software development companies often tailor employee-level enterprise applications to specific roles or departments. These apps have some examples like?
Department-Level Enterprise Application??
A company may control a specific functional area through a departmental-level enterprise application. These applications stand as specialized software solutions designed to assist within an organization.
Developers tailor department-level enterprise applications to execute the tasks of each department. These applications have focused functionality as their main highlight and integrate with enterprise-wide systems.
So, department-level enterprise applications ensure seamless data exchange and allow companies to make better decision-making by providing insights.?
Some prime examples of department-level enterprise applications:
Company-Level Enterprise Application?
Businesses may rely on company-level enterprise applications as the backbone of their organizational operations. These apps have features for customization, integration into external systems, and scalability.
Company-level enterprise applications support enterprise digital transformation and enable seamless coordination. They allow data exchange across departments, optimize resources, streamline processes, and improve decision-making.
Companies may depend on company-level enterprise applications to manage critical data and insights. These applications offer a centralized repository and facilitate teamwork and strategic planning across different organization’s departments and levels.?
Some examples of company-level enterprise applications:
Importance of Enterprise Mobile Apps
Organizations may leave their worries about complicated tasks to enterprise mobile apps. This application can make communication effortless among the departments.
Also, companies may achieve the greatest operational efficiency through enterprise mobile application development services. These services help organizations achieve optimized profits at an affordable cost.
But let’s look at other beneficial points to understand the importance of enterprise mobile apps.?
Mobile Accounting?
Enterprise mobile apps have the most significant feature, mobile accounting. This feature allows users to edit and check the generated expenses and other business transactions.
Marketing Tool?
Contacting an enterprise app development company can help businesses benefit from enterprise mobile apps. These companies assist businesses in winning over their competitors when enterprise mobile apps work as marketing tools.
Thus, businesses save resources by investing them in traditional marketing methods such as brochures and pamphlets.
An enterprise mobile app efficiently provides companies with information about new launches, discounts, newsfeeds, or other activities.
These apps have boosted their popularity as marketing tools through push notifications, a highly beneficial and preferred feature that allows entrepreneurs to send alert messages about discounts, coupons, or other offers to users.
In short, push notifications are marketing tools in enterprise mobile apps that help businesses improve their product sales and revenue.?
Excellent Deals?
You may manage your business transitions and third-party payments through enterprise mobile apps. These apps allow users to include the payment feature in mobile apps. This process depends on the user's requirements and business goals.
Enhanced Data Management?
Every organization wishes to secure its data or a critical asset at any cost. This data deals with customers, but every company cannot manage that data.
So, these organizations wish for appropriate enterprise mobile apps that manage the company's critical data without errors.?
Also, your mobile phone has access to all the information about the enterprise.?
Better Communication?
Your business may enhance its internal connections to clients through enterprise mobile apps' communication features, which include video conferencing, collaboration tools, and instant messaging.?
Efficient Operations?
Enterprise mobile apps allow efficient business operations and improved workflow. These apps automate tasks, reduce manual data entry, and eliminate paper-based processes.
Enhance Customer Experience?
You may depend on enterprise mobile apps to enhance the customer experience and engagement. These apps provide real-time access to account information, self-service options, and support resources.?
Budget-Friendly?
Enterprise mobile application development services may help your company achieve long-term cost savings. These applications optimize resource allocation and processes by reducing manual work on your organization's team.?
Productivity and Real-time Insights?
Enterprise mobile apps enhance productivity and efficiency in any organization. These apps offer employees real-time access to crucial tools like CRM systems, email, and project management. You may gain prompt access to vital business data through enterprise mobile applications. These apps empower stakeholders with real-time insights for well-informed decision-making.?
Enterprise Mobile Application Development Features
User Authentication
You may understand that user authentication mechanisms typically include username/password combinations. They also involve biometric authentication, such as fingerprint or facial recognition.
Also, user authentication mechanisms consist of multi-factor authentication, requiring additional verification methods like OTP codes or security tokens. These mechanisms include single sign-on (SSO) integrations with identity providers.
The app asks users to log in with accurate credentials or authentication using biometric data or other factors. These data remain verified against stored user records or external identity providers.
Thus, the app avoids unauthorized access, data breaches, and fraud.?
RBAC (Role-Based Access Control)?
Organizations become more empowered through RBAC to control access to sensitive data, functionality, and features within the app. These apps permit users to decide which users or team members have access based on roles and permissions.
Also, RBAC allows companies to define roles with specific access rights while ensuring security and compliance.?
Workflow Automation?
Enterprise apps automate repetitive tasks, business processes, and workflows. It allows companies to reduce manual effort and errors, increasing their productivity.
领英推荐
Thus, enterprise application developers should include some features that automate tasks. They should focus on adding features that accelerate decision-making while ensuring consistency across operations.?
Artificial Intelligence(AI) & Machine Learning (ML) Algorithms?
The enterprise app development methods have transformed through emerging technologies like AI and ML. You may rely on enterprise software development companies that hire mobile app developers.
These developers include AI and ML algorithms in the app to analyze data, identify patterns, and make predictions or recommendations. These features would help your organization gain insights into future trends.
Your company may understand customer behavior and explore better business opportunities through these features.?
Security and Compliance?
You would be glad to know that enterprise applications comply with industry regulations. These applications must comply with industry standards and internal policies relevant to data privacy, security, and governance.
So, enterprise mobile application development developers should implement all security measures and use two-factor and multi-factor authentication.
This step helps developers use technologies like OpenID Connect protocol and OAuth 2.0 framework.?
Cross-Platform Compatibility?
The growth of any application depends on compatibility across various platforms like iOS, Android, and others.
With this in mind, you should prioritize this feature during enterprise application development. It allows users to access critical business functions, irrespective of their devices.?
Collaboration Tools?
Businesses will benefit when they choose enterprise mobile applications with messaging features. These apps also have other characteristics like project collaboration, document-sharing tools, reporting, and real-time document editing.
Such tools allow employees to share knowledge, communicate, and perform teamwork without restrictions on their location or time zone.?
Offline Data Synchronisation?
Through offline data synchronization, users can access, update, and interact with application data while remaining offline or having poor internet connectivity.
It prevents users or team members from facing buffering or interruption during their work, regardless of their network status or location. The application catches relevant data locally on their devices, especially when users go offline.
The locally stored data goes into synchronization mode when the device reconnects with the internet. It reflects changes made offline in the system and downloads updates from other users.?
Voice Recognition and Natural Language Processing (NLP)
These features allow users to interact with the app using voice commands or NLP queries. It assists users in performing tasks and retrieving information. Also, voice recognition and NLP save time by navigating the app with their voice. NLP answers common queries automatically, saving manual efforts.?
Analytics & Reporting?
This feature provides valuable insights into business performance, opportunities, and trends. Enterprise mobile applications have advanced capabilities, including predictive analytics, data visualization, and real-time reporting. These attributes empower decision-makers to make informed decisions and drive strategic initiatives.
Future of Enterprise Mobile App Development?
User Experience?
User experience is the backbone of enterprise mobile applications. If you fail to provide your customers with an excellent user experience, they will not return to use your app. This makes user experience a crucial feature when considering the digital landscape.
So, connect with the best enterprise app development company to offer the best applications for the target audience.
They hire mobile app developers ?to create an easy-to-use, effective, and valuable app design. These companies understand that a well-planned and designed mobile app provides a flawless user experience.??
Design?
You may need to focus on the app’s design, as developing an enterprise mobile app does not complete your responsibility.
The developers should focus on a well-designed and well-thought-out design that works well on the device and attracts and retains customers. Your app will fail if you ignore this step before initiating the mobile app development process.
So, the UI plays a very important role in the mobile app world in attracting the audience's attention.?
5G Technology
It has already transformed the entire mobile industry, changing the way people use mobile apps. The 5G technology has become significant in the enterprise mobile app development process . It increases the data-sharing speeds for mobile phones and decreases the latency.
Blockchain?
This technology helps provide increased data security in enterprise mobile app development. When developed with blockchain, the apps become highly secure and provide increased data privacy.
Blockchain plays an active role in every industrial transformation, including enterprises. You may embrace blockchain in your business through multiple methods.
These methods involve better supply chain management, a transparent payment system, an effective hiring process, and unbreachable security.?
Wearables?
With the advancement of technology, enterprises have started to focus more on designing better. They develop enterprise mobile apps that connect with wearable gadgets to deliver information in different ways.
The developers believe this step would transform the number of products and services in distinct industry spaces. These industries often involve fitness, healthcare, fashion, and sports.
Connecting wearable gadgets with smartphones will improve the user experience staggeringly. This would impact enterprise mobile app development and future-generation strategists.?
IoT & Cloud?
Businesses marked changes in their methods of doing business through IoT development and cloud computing.
Developers integrate cloud computing technology into the process of enterprise app development. This streamlines operations, reduces hosting and equipment costs, and more.
Further, IoT development or cloud technologies allow mobile apps to function across multiple platforms.?
Big Data Analytics?
Analytics checks how different things work on an app and plays a crucial role in technological innovation. Before implementing analytics, you should ensure that it remains appropriate to your business goals.
However, analytics would help you enhance the mobile app’s performance after its implementation.
Businesses should understand that capturing, storing, and utilizing mobile analytics data stays significant. It allows better user interactions and engagement for your business.?
AI?
Artificial Intelligence (AI) has become more valuable in enterprise mobile app development. It helps mobile apps learn about their users and deliver a personalized user experience.
In short, AI collects and stores user data. It offers a high level of intelligence by analyzing user behavior and interaction with the app.?
AR and VR?
These technologies have transformed the enterprise mobile app development industry. With the help of AR and VR technologies, mobile app developers provide a better user experience.
Augmented and virtual reality assist enterprise mobile app developers in driving customer engagement. These technologies help in engineering, training, games, education, healthcare, and entertainment.?
Why Choose MobileCoderz for Enterprise Mobile Application Development?
MobileCoderz is one of the most reliable mobile application development companies in the USA. It hires mobile app developers who offer the best custom mobile app development services.
The developers dedicate themselves to helping businesses flourish, considering their audience type. MobileCoderz has become the best enterprise software development company offering budget-friendly cost of mobile app development.
We develop high-quality enterprise mobile application development services with feature-rich, innovative, and scalable mobile apps. Our developers have complete knowledge of iPhone app development , depending on the client’s demand.
We promise to help you use smartphones' hottest features without difficulty through our latest enterprise mobile app development services. You can trust MobileCoderz as an affordable enterprise app development company for all your related services.
Contact us today to learn more about how we can help your business grow through our innovative mobile app development solutions.